STURROCK HOPES TO KICK HABIT

Posted on: Fri 27 Aug 2010

Manager Paul Sturrock does not want losing to become a habit for his Southend United side.

His side visit Bradford City this evening with just one win from their opening five matches of the season.

And boss Sturrock knows his side must soon put things right as he bids to get his team moving in the right direction.

"Winning becomes a habit but so does losing and we have to break that as quickly as we can," said Sturrock.

"It's been a difficult start to the season and the standard of our opposition has played a part in that.

"They have been tough games and this evening's one will be as well because Bradford are a good side.

"But we need to get three points as quickly as we can and it would be great to move up the table before everyone else plays tomorrow."

Blues, who are 22nd in the early League Two standings, go in to the game at Valley Parade on the back of an encouraging Carling Cup display at Wolverhampton Wanderers on Tuesday night.
